The Evolving Payment Landscape: From ISO to PayFac to Embedded Infrastructure

The payments ecosystem was built on well-defined roles: ISOs referred, acquirers settled, PSPs integrated, PayFacs bundled, ISVs stayed in their software domain. Digital commerce has dissolved those boundaries. This is a look at what each role actually meant, why the lines blurred, and what replaces them.

Outgrowing the traditional structure

The structure of the payments ecosystem has historically been based on well-defined roles. Independent Sales Organizations (ISOs), Payment Service Providers (PSPs), Acquirers, Payment Facilitators (PayFacs), and Independent Software Vendors (ISVs) each occupied a distinct position in the value chain.

However, as digital commerce has grown in complexity and scale, these roles are converging. Today, the industry is shifting away from rigid categorisation toward modular, composable infrastructure.

What was once a sequence of handoffs is increasingly becoming a network of interoperable functions.

The legacy roles, and where their boundaries sat

ISO (Independent Sales Organization)
A third-party agent that refers merchants to acquirers and facilitates their onboarding. ISOs historically managed sales relationships but did not own technical infrastructure or compliance. An ISO does not process or collect funds: it is a commercial channel, not a regulated one.
Acquirer (or acquiring bank)
A financial institution that processes card transactions on behalf of a merchant and settles funds into their account. Acquirers are responsible for scheme membership, underwriting, and risk. An acquirer is a settlement entity, though some modern players — Adyen, for example — hold both roles, acquirer and PayFac.
PSP (Payment Service Provider)
A technology provider that enables merchants to accept various payment methods, including cards, wallets, and bank transfers, typically through a single API integration. PSP is also a legal status, allowing an entity to collect funds for third parties under PSD2 in Europe.
PayFac (Payment Facilitator)
An entity that acts as a master merchant, onboarding sub-merchants under its own account to simplify integration and accelerate go-to-market. A PayFac is a role defined by the card schemes, often layered on top of a PSP licence.
ISV (Independent Software Vendor)
A company providing software solutions — for retail, hospitality or fitness, for instance — that embed payments as part of the workflow. ISVs are increasingly influential as distribution and control layers for payment functionality. An ISV may embed payments but doesn't necessarily touch funds.

How small and large merchants bought payments, before the lines blurred

Smaller merchantsLarger merchants
Route to marketBundled or agent-led, via ISOs, ISVs or resellersDirect engagement with providers
Relationships to manageOne, with pre-integrated services beneath itSeveral — acquirers, PSPs and fraud vendors, each negotiated
What was prioritisedSpeed and ease of setup, not controlOptionality and influence over configuration
VisibilityLittle sight of routing, fees or optimisation leversProvider selection and configuration largely their own call
How payments were treatedAs a utilityAs a negotiated commercial arrangement
Degree of customisationPre-integrated, all-in-one, limited flexibilityGreater flexibility, though rarely a fully custom-built stack

Modularity disrupts the chain

Once upon a time, the payments industry was relatively easy to map. ISOs introduced. Acquirers settled. PSPs integrated. PayFacs bundled. ISVs focused on their own software domains. Each actor had a defined title, clear boundaries, and a single function.

But the demands of digital commerce — speed, flexibility, cross-border capability, and embedded experiences — have blurred those lines. As eCommerce matured and platforms expanded across geographies and verticals, the linear logic of traditional roles began to feel out of step with the way modern merchants operate. What once functioned as a clearly segmented path now overlaps in functionality, technology, and merchant expectation. Merchants no longer think in terms of isolated providers, but in terms of end-to-end performance, flexibility, and value.

In response, roles began to overlap

  • PSPs expanded into orchestration, routing, and analytics.
  • Acquirers introduced various value-added services, including fraud modules.
  • ISOs embedded technical dashboards, support layers, and custom integrations.
  • ISVs began embedding full payment stacks into their platforms, becoming payment enablers in their own right.

As platforms and APIs matured, the old distinction between how small and large merchants bought payments began to dissolve too. Today, even small or mid-sized players can access modular tools, orchestrate across providers, and compose a stack that reflects their operational needs, without building everything from scratch.

A new class of infrastructure provider

A new wave of infrastructure providers has also entered the payments space, designed from the ground up with modularity and flexibility in mind. Unlike legacy players, these entrants are cloud-native, API-first, and built to be embedded seamlessly into modern digital ecosystems.

  • Core processing
    Some focus on core processing, offering alternatives to traditional acquirers with real-time settlement capabilities and simplified scheme connectivity.
  • Orchestration
    Others specialise in orchestration, acting as middleware that intelligently routes transactions, manages retries, and connects multiple service layers without the need for custom code.
  • Data and compliance infrastructure
    Another group is emerging around data and compliance infrastructure, offering token vaults, identity verification, and secure handling of sensitive payment credentials. Their role is to abstract risk and reduce the compliance burden for platforms.

The ISO and ISV repositioned as operators

ISOs are worth a closer look, because their evolution encapsulates the broader shift. Traditionally seen as distribution arms focused on merchant acquisition and referral, ISOs operated at the periphery of the payment stack. As technology became more accessible and infrastructure more modular, they moved closer to the centre — and their repositioning reveals how non-technical actors are now stepping into technical roles.

  • Middle-layer builders
    Developing white-label or proprietary platforms that sit between the merchant and the processor.
  • Relationship owners
    Offering onboarding support, operational insights, and escalation pathways.
  • Strategic enablers
    Providing advice on stack configuration, payment performance, and compliance requirements.

The age of the modular stack

ISVs, in particular, are shifting from pure software distribution to revenue-sharing partners and orchestration layers. Many embed PayFac capabilities or route through multiple PSPs while maintaining ownership of the merchant relationship. With deep industry knowledge and proximity to merchant pain points, both ISOs and ISVs are becoming ecosystem integrators — adding value through specialisation, service, and embedded infrastructure.

Building an end-to-end payment stack used to be a badge of honour, and a costly one. Today, platforms and merchants no longer need to choose between building everything or outsourcing it all. Instead, they compose what they need, combining ownership and partnership in ways that align with strategy, speed, and cost.

Payment infrastructure is unbundling. From tokenisation to compliance to transaction monitoring, nearly every component is now available as a service:

  • Startups can launch with a light footprint.
  • Enterprises can test and swap layers without overhauling entire architectures.
  • Mid-sized platforms can compete on experience without bearing the full cost of ownership.

Rather than buying monolithic stacks or building everything in-house, businesses now plug into onboarding engines, use third-party fraud tools, layer token vaults without managing scheme certification, and route across PSPs using orchestration engines.

This modularity marks a fundamental shift: payment providers are no longer defined by what they were traditionally licensed to do, but by the capabilities they offer.

The third wave: Infrastructure-as-a-Service

Payment is no longer just a checkout feature. It is foundational infrastructure — modular by design, and embedded across product, operations, finance, and customer experience.

As the payments landscape matures, a new category is emerging: Infrastructure-as-a-Service. Unlike PayFac-as-a-Service, which simplifies merchant onboarding and compliance under a shared master MID, IaaS unbundles deeper layers — routing, tokenisation, FX and more — into configurable components. These infrastructure providers operate largely behind the scenes, with no merchant-facing role, and without requiring ownership of licensing or scheme relationships.

This model allows platforms to plug into advanced payment capabilities without owning the full stack, enabling more flexibility, scalability, and control over the user experience:

  • Smart routing across PSPs and acquirers
  • Tokenisation vaults
  • Unified reconciliation
  • Embedded FX and payout engines

Three shifts accelerating the demand

  • Platformisation of commerce
    Marketplaces, SaaS platforms, and aggregators want to own the commercial and user experience without being constrained by legacy acquirer logic.
  • Hyper-regionalisation
    Merchants selling cross-border need local acquiring, acceptance, and compliance support. Infrastructure partners can abstract this through a single integration.
  • The need for differentiation
    Payments are no longer passive. Smart routing, real-time monitoring, and tokenisation strategies have become competitive differentiators.

Access over ownership

What began as a channel play (ISO) and transitioned into a product-led model (PayFac) is now evolving into a service-first, infrastructure-centric world. As the lines between acquirers, PSPs, ISOs, and orchestrators blur, control, modularity, and integration flexibility are becoming the guiding design principles for modern payment strategies.

Rather than asking who owns the stack, the more relevant question is who can configure it, and how fast. This shift doesn't require every player to become an infrastructure provider. On the contrary, the emergence of Infrastructure-as-a-Service and PayFac-as-a-Service models reflects a growing demand for access over ownership. Platforms and intermediaries no longer need to build or license everything themselves; they can assemble high-performing payment capabilities from interoperable services.

ISOs, for example, are repositioning themselves as value-added partners, bringing underwriting experience, vertical knowledge — healthcare, B2B, high-risk — and localised onboarding to the table. Their relevance lies in their ability to navigate complexity: not in owning the rails, but in knowing how to orchestrate them.

Those who remain static risk losing touch with market expectations. Those who evolve, whether as builders, connectors, or advisors, will shape the next generation of embedded commerce.

Frequently asked questions

What is the difference between an ISO and a PSP?
An ISO is a commercial channel; a PSP is a technical and regulated one. An Independent Sales Organization refers merchants to acquirers and handles the sales relationship, but does not own technical infrastructure or compliance and never processes or collects funds. A Payment Service Provider supplies the technology that lets a merchant accept cards, wallets and bank transfers through a single API — and PSP is also a legal status, allowing an entity to collect funds for third parties under PSD2 in Europe.
What does a PayFac actually do?
A Payment Facilitator acts as a master merchant, onboarding sub-merchants under its own account so they don't each need a direct acquiring relationship. That simplifies integration and accelerates go-to-market. PayFac is a role defined by the card schemes rather than a licence in itself, and it is often layered on top of a PSP licence.
Is an acquirer the same as a PSP?
No, though the distinction is eroding. An acquirer is a financial institution and a settlement entity: it processes card transactions, settles funds into the merchant's account, and carries scheme membership, underwriting and risk. A PSP is a technology provider enabling acceptance across payment methods. Some modern players hold both roles at once — Adyen, for example, is both acquirer and PayFac.
What is Infrastructure-as-a-Service in payments?
An emerging category in which deeper layers of the payment stack — routing, tokenisation, FX and more — are unbundled into configurable components that a platform can plug into. IaaS providers operate largely behind the scenes, with no merchant-facing role, and without requiring the platform to own licensing or scheme relationships. It lets a business access advanced payment capabilities without owning the full stack.
How is IaaS different from PayFac-as-a-Service?
PayFac-as-a-Service simplifies merchant onboarding and compliance under a shared master MID. Infrastructure-as-a-Service goes further down the stack, unbundling routing, tokenisation, FX and reconciliation into components you configure independently. Both reflect the same underlying demand — access over ownership — but PayFac-as-a-Service addresses the onboarding layer while IaaS addresses the infrastructure beneath it.
Do I still need to build my own payment stack?
Rarely, and that is the substantive change. Building end to end used to be a badge of honour and a costly one; the choice is no longer between building everything and outsourcing it all. Nearly every component — tokenisation, compliance, transaction monitoring, onboarding, fraud tooling, orchestration — is available as a service, so startups can launch with a light footprint, enterprises can swap layers without overhauling their architecture, and mid-sized platforms can compete on experience without carrying the full cost of ownership.
Are ISOs still relevant?
Yes, but in a different position. ISOs have moved from the periphery of the stack towards its centre, becoming middle-layer builders of white-label platforms, owners of the merchant relationship, and strategic advisers on stack configuration and compliance. Their relevance now comes from underwriting experience, vertical knowledge in areas like healthcare, B2B and high-risk, and localised onboarding — not from owning the rails, but from knowing how to orchestrate them.
